Function union

  • Creates an array of unique values from all given arrays.

    This function takes two arrays, merges them into a single array, and returns a new array containing only the unique values from the merged array.

    Type Parameters

    • T

      The type of elements in the array.

    Parameters

    • arr1: readonly T[]

      The first array to merge and filter for unique values.

    • arr2: readonly T[]

      The second array to merge and filter for unique values.

    Returns T[]

    A new array of unique values.

    const array1 = [1, 2, 3];
    const array2 = [3, 4, 5];
    const result = union(array1, array2);
    // result will be [1, 2, 3, 4, 5]